Location of the Festival
The festival takes place at Balloon Fiesta Park in Albuquerque, New Mexico. This open area provides the space needed for safe balloon launches and crowd movement.
The nearby Sandia Mountains create stunning backdrops during sunrise flights. The location also allows easy access from hotels, highways, and public transport.

Dates and Times
The albuquerque balloon festival 2024 ran from October 5 through October 13. Most morning events started before sunrise due to ideal wind conditions.
Evening sessions featured balloon glows and light displays. Daily schedules changed based on weather and safety checks.

Weather and Flight Conditions
Weather played a critical role in how each festival day unfolded at the albuquerque balloon festival 2024, as balloon flights depended heavily on calm and stable conditions. Cool early mornings and light winds created the safest environment for launches, which is why most flights happened shortly after sunrise.
Albuquerque is known for a unique wind pattern that allows pilots to change direction by adjusting altitude. This natural advantage helped pilots control their balloons more effectively and made the location ideal for consistent and safe balloon flights.
